The Introduction to Physics syllabus template provides a structured framework for educators to outline a foundational physics course. It covers 19 nodes across key sections including Course Description, Course Overview, Learning Objectives, and What to Expect. The template details major topics such as motion, energy, forces, and matter, and includes specific learning objectives like 'Understand fundamental principles of physics' and 'Analyze scientific data and experiments'. This syllabus template serves as a comprehensive guide for both instructors and students, ensuring clear communication of course expectations and goals. It is ideal for designing an introductory physics curriculum that emphasizes critical thinking and problem-solving skills.

Open the .xmind file in Xmind (desktop or web version).
Review the existing structure: Course Description, Course Overview, Learning Objectives, and What to Expect.
Replace the placeholder text in each node with your specific course information, such as your university's name, course title, and instructor details.
Expand or modify branches as needed—add weekly topics under 'Timeline of Topics' or additional learning objectives.
Export the completed syllabus as PDF, image, or share the .xmind file with colleagues for collaboration.
